The Facts:
Monday, HC Joe Gibbs told reporters Portis had suffered another bout of tendinitis in his right knee, but that was incorrect. Gibbs was assuming that was the case, according to the club, and misspoke. Head trainer Bubba Tyer just told reporters that Portis actually has a bruise and a sprained right knee (grade 1, the most minor sprain possible), suffered in the first quarter of the Giants game.

Fantasy Football Diehards Line:
Tyer believes Clinton will play Sunday, but it will be day by day with Portis and and receiver Santana Moss, who has not yet run since hurting his groin. ... Stay tuned, more on both players as the week progresses.
